Prince Andrew vehemently denies the claims made in a legal action by Ms Roberts that he abused her as an under-age girl at an orgy where she was being used as a âsex slaveâ.
The legal allegation states that Ms Roberts was âforcedâ to have sex with the royal at parties in London, New York and the Caribbean.

She claims she was told to âgive the prince whatever he demandedâ by his friend Epstein â the US paedophile who hosted the parties â and that she was converted âinto what is commonly referred to as a sex slaveâ.
Ms Robert’s father Sky Roberts spoke out this weekend to support his daughter, who is now 30, and said her claims should be tested in court.
He said: âI brought up my children and that includes Virginia to always tell the truth ⊠Why would she lie?â
In court documents, Ms Roberts â who is not named â says she was âprocured for sexual activitiesâ for Epstein by Ghislaine Maxwell, the socialite daughter of crooked tycoon Robert Maxwell.
Ms Maxwell is alleged to have facilitated the princeâs âabuseâ of the girl. The legal documents, lodged with a Florida court, name Ms Maxwell as a âmadameâ and a âprimary co-conspirator in [Epsteinâs] sexual abuse and sex trafficking schemeâ.
She has previously branded all claims against her as âuntrueâ and âobvious liesâ. The court papers name Andrew, 54, as one of three men allegedly involved in abusing âJane Doe #3â when she was 17 â under-age according to Florida state law.
Epstein, a long-term friend of Andrew, was jailed for 13 months in 2008 for soliciting girls for under-age prostitution. The pair remained friends and were seen together in 2011 after Epsteinâs release.
On Friday a Buckingham Palace spokesman said âany suggestion of impropriety with under-age minors is categorically untrueâ.
Andrewâs accuser countered the statement, saying via her lawyers that she is an âinnocent victimâ and: âIâm not going to be bullied back into silence.â
